When and where will the 2025/26 Ashes be played?
The five-Test series begins in Perth on November 21. The full schedule for the Ashes is as follows:
- 1st Test: Perth Stadium, Perth – November 21 (10:20am local time)
- 2nd Test: The Gabba, Brisbane – December 4 (2:00pm local time - Day/Night)
- 3rd Test: Adelaide Oval, Adelaide – December 17 (10:00am local time)
- 4th Test: Melbourne Cricket Ground, Melbourne – December 26 (10:30am local time)
- 5th Test: Sydney Cricket Ground, Sydney – January 4 (10:30am local time)
The Ashes 2025/26: Where to watch live on TV channels and live streaming platforms in the UK
TNT Sport will broadcast the series for fans in the UK, with live streaming provided by discovery+.
Viewers in the UK can subscribe to TNT Sports via discovery+, BT, EE, Sky, and Virgin Media.
Radio coverage of the Ashes will be provided by BBC Test Match Special. This can be accessed via BBC Sounds, BBC Radio 5 Sports Extra or the BBC Sport website and app.

The Ashes 2025/26: Full squads and team lists
Australia (first Test): Steve Smith (c), Scott Boland, Alex Carey, Brendan Doggett, Cameron Green, Travis Head, Josh Inglis, Usman Khawaja, Marnus Labuschagne, Nathan Lyon, Michael Neser, Mitchell Starc, Jake Weatherald, Beau Webster.
England: Ben Stokes (c), Jofra Archer, Gus Atkinson, Shoaib Bashir, Jacob Bethell, Harry Brook, Brydon Carse, Zak Crawley, Ben Duckett, Will Jacks, Ollie Pope, Matthew Potts, Joe Root, Jamie Smith, Josh Tongue, Mark Wood.
